Name : axis Product : Fedora 27 Version : 1.4 Release : 35.fc27 URL : http://ws.apache.org/axis/ Summary : SOAP implementation in Java Description : Apache AXIS is an implementation of the SOAP ("Simple Object Access Protocol") submission to W3C.
From the draft W3C specification:
SOAP is a lightweight protocol for exchange of information in a decentralized, distributed environment. It is an XML based protocol that consists of three parts: an envelope that defines a framework for describing what is in a message and how to process it, a set of encoding rules for expressing instances of application-defined datatypes, and a convention for representing remote procedure calls and responses.
This project is a follow-on to the Apache SOAP project.
------------------------------------------------------------------------------- - Update Information:
Fixes CVE-2018-8032, an XSS attack in axis-based services. ------------------------------------------------------------------------------- - ChangeLog:
* Mon Aug 13 2018 Mat Booth <mat.booth@redhat.com> - 0:1.4-35 - Fix for CVE-2018-8032 ------------------------------------------------------------------------------- - References:
[ 1 ] Bug #1611835 - CVE-2018-8032 axis: cross-site scripting (XSS) attack in the default servlet/services https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1611835 ------------------------------------------------------------------------------- -
This update can be installed with the "dnf" update program. Use su -c 'dnf upgrade --advisory FEDORA-2018-8a85ed2f10' at the command line. For more information, refer to the dnf documentation available at http://dnf.readthedocs.io/en/latest/command_ref.html#upgrade-command-label
